Geneva, the second-largest city in Switzerland, is a global hub for diplomacy and international relations. It is home to numerous international organizations, including the United Nations. The city boasts a rich history, cultural diversity, and stunning natural beauty, with its picturesque location on the shores of Lake Geneva (Lac Léman) and surrounded by the Jura Mountains.

💡

Geneva is a walkable city, and using public transport is efficient. Don't miss the local markets for fresh produce and souvenirs. Consider purchasing a Geneva Card for free public transport and discounts on attractions.

How to Reach Geneva

✈️

By Air

Fastest travel, Comfort
Nearest AirportGeneva Cointrin International Airport (4 km)

Direct flights from major European and international cities to Geneva International Airport.

Connecting flights through Zurich or other European hubs.

🚂

By Train

Scenic routes, Environmentally friendly
Nearest StationGeneva Cornavin Railway Station (GVA) (0 km)

High-speed trains from Paris, Lyon, Milan, and Zurich to Geneva.

Swiss Federal Railways (SBB) connects Geneva to other Swiss cities.

🚌

By Road

Scenic drives, Flexibility

Geneva is well-connected by highways to neighboring cities and countries.

Regular bus services from nearby cities like Annecy and Lausanne.

Best Time to Visit Geneva

🌤️

The best times to visit Geneva are in the spring (April-May) and autumn (September-October) when the weather is mild and pleasant. Summer can be busy with tourists, while winter offers a festive atmosphere, especially around Christmas.

Travel Tips & Practical Info

💰

Budget Tips

Use public transport, eat at local markets or supermarkets, and take advantage of free attractions like the Jet d'Eau and Jardin Botanique.

🙏

Cultural Etiquette

Switzerland is known for punctuality and respect for rules. Greet locals with a handshake or 'Bonjour/Bonjourne' and dress modestly when visiting churches.

⚠️

Common Scams

Be wary of overly friendly strangers approaching you for surveys or donations. Always check prices before ordering at cafés.

🌙

Night Safety

Geneva is very safe at night, but be cautious in less crowded areas. Keep an eye on your belongings in tourist hotspots.
